Automobile car dealerships give a range of solutions associated to the purchasing and marketing of automobiles. One of their main features is to serve as middlemans (or middlemen) between auto manufacturers and consumers, acquiring cars directly from the maker and after that offering them to consumers at a markup. Additionally, they usually supply funding options for buyers and will assist with the trade-in or sale of a client's old automobile.
